Chapter 73 The speed of progress of terror(2/2)

"Warning, Corporal Chen Feng, No. 89757, you have made an extreme operation that exceeds your own training experience. It is recommended that you adjust the parameters to prevent injury."

At this moment, the electronic referee sound came from Chen Feng's helmet, and at the same time, he fell into the mud again.

But after falling a lot, he was more experienced, so he simply curled up into a ball and rolled forward.

He rolled out dozens of meters before regaining his balance and continuing to run forward at a speed of 6g.

Observers outside could also hear the machine reminder that Chen Feng received, and couldn't help but feel extremely worried.

At the same time, Chen Feng replied simply and neatly: "Reject the callback, reject the prompt, don't affect me."

"After receiving the order, Corporal Chen Feng, do you want to activate the personal autonomous mode? Similar reminders will be blocked by then."

"Turn on."

After Chen Feng finished speaking, he raised the parameter to 6.5g.

"This guy is crazy! Why don't you slow down a little?"

Someone in the crowd cursed the beast.

Ding Hu said helplessly: "He may have seen that those in front were too far behind, and was afraid that it would take time to adapt."

"Professor Ouyang, if Chen Feng continues like this, how long will it take for him to be injured?"

The general spoke again.

Professor Ouyang squinted his eyes, and after a long moment he shook his head, "It seems he won't be injured. This guy took advantage of a bug in the simulator."

General: "How do you say that?"

"Once he fell, he didn't even think about regaining his balance. Instead, he curled up into a ball and rolled forward. If it were on a real battlefield, he would definitely hit something during the rolling process, or his head would be hit.

On the bumps along the way. But this is a simulator after all, and the lowest life support system setting has the highest priority. It is impossible for the simulator's robotic arm to simulate a stone impact to attack him, so he only needs to gather his body in time,

No one will be hurt."

The general was stunned for a moment, then smiled, "You cunning guy has taken advantage of the machine's loopholes. But it is reasonable after all. Machines are machines after all, and they exist to be used by humans. The most unique thing about him is that

It still only needs to be dropped once to adapt to the operation feeling under the new acceleration state. Then if it is replaced with a real machine, he can also control it."

Ding Hu burst into tears, "Yes, you only have to throw it once."

Back then, every time he improved by 0.1g, he had to at least...

Forget it, it’s hard to look back on the past.

"The next step is the key step. This is a long-distance cross-country run. The terrain will become rugged and the difficulty of operation will suddenly increase. Because he cannot accelerate to the limit all at once, it is best to hit the high point every time he lands.

, then he has to constantly find the most perfect acceleration state, light when it should be light, heavy when it should be heavy, and he must accurately grasp the optimal limit distance of each leap."

Professor Ouyang explained, "This is difficult, really very difficult."

An experienced veteran of the competition later added: "There will also be requirements to change direction from time to time and to avoid obstructions."
